{"title":"Olive Trees","description":"\u003cp\u003eThe first decision on this page is whether you want fruit at all. Ripe olives drop, stain pale paving and get walked indoors, and birds carry the seed into bushland, so fruiting olives count as an environmental weed in South Australia and parts of Victoria and New South Wales. On lawn or gravel, well back from the entry, that is a sweeping job. Backing onto a reserve, check your council listing before you order a row.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003ch3\u003eIf the fruit is the problem\u003c\/h3\u003e\u003cp\u003e\u003ca href=\"\/products\/olive-olea-europaea-swan-hill\"\u003eSwan Hill\u003c\/a\u003e was selected in northern Victoria as a non fruiting form. It sets next to nothing and sheds very little viable pollen. Buy it for the grey canopy and never for a harvest. \u003ca href=\"\/products\/olive-olea-europaea-tolleys-upright\"\u003eTolleys Upright\u003c\/a\u003e is the other low litter answer. Fruiting is light next to the commercial cultivars, and it holds its branches close to a central axis instead of sprawling.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003ch3\u003eTable fruit and oil\u003c\/h3\u003e\u003cp\u003eNothing here goes from branch to plate; raw olives are bitter and need curing first. \u003ca href=\"\/products\/olive-olea-europaea-kalamata\"\u003eKalamata\u003c\/a\u003e is the tapered purple black Greek table cultivar, but flower set depends on a genuinely cold winter, so it crops in central Victoria and sulks in a warm coastal garden further north. Manzanillo is the rounded Spanish green, broader and lower branching than the upright types, and Californian Queen and Mission fill out the table group. Table cultivars set a heavier crop with a second variety flowering nearby, and they bear biennially, a heavy year then a light one. Keep the lot of them off driveways, pool surrounds, light coloured concrete and pale render. On the oil side \u003ca href=\"\/products\/olive-olea-europaea-frantoio\"\u003eFrantoio\u003c\/a\u003e is self fertile and crops on its own, and Verdale is a South Australian oil cultivar, at home in hot dry summers on alkaline limestone ground. Correggiola is the Tuscan oil olive that also travels under the Frantoio label, with pendulous branches and a name as a pollinator. Nevadillo Blanco is an Andalusian oil variety planted here mainly for its upright, well furnished shape.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003ch3\u003eSun and drainage decide it\u003c\/h3\u003e\u003cp\u003eFull sun is not negotiable. In shade an olive stretches, thins out, stops flowering, then rots at the base over a wet winter, and feeding will not fix it. On the basalt clay through Melbourne's west a deep hole turns into a sump by July, so plant proud of the grade on a mound. High pH is a non issue, which is why Perth limestone sand suits an olive. Humidity is the real limit: through Brisbane and the northern rivers olives run leggy and fruit poorly. Check leaf undersides in spring for olive lace bug, which mottles the foliage grey from below before anything shows on top; it builds up quickly in a congested canopy. Prune in late winter to an open vase so light reaches the inner wood. Light regular clipping holds a shape, but an olive that has run away is not lost: it breaks readily from old wood, so a hard renovation cut is a real option in the ground. Go lighter in a pot, where there is less in reserve to push the regrowth. Where many olives sprawl and need training to lift a canopy, Mission holds a narrower, more vertical frame with a strong leader, which is why it gets used for avenues, driveway rows and tall informal screens rather than as a spreading feature tree. It also carries a reputation as one of the more cold tolerant selections, so it copes with frosty inland winters better than most.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eThe fruit is dual purpose, ripening black and used both for table curing and for oil. Like any olive it crops far more heavily in some years than others, and in a landscape setting that crop is often more nuisance than benefit.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eFull sun, freely draining soil and very little water once established. Expect the same evergreen grey green foliage and the same slow to moderate pace, simply on a tighter frame.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eContainer culture is where it earns its keep, and also where things go wrong. Olives loathe wet feet, so use a free draining potting mix, skip the saucer, and give the pot full sun. They tolerate dry spells, but not a pot that goes bone dry over and over through summer while trying to hold a dense canopy. Clip after the main growth flush rather than in midwinter, and keep pruning light and regular instead of cutting back into old bare wood.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003ch3 class=\"pd-size-guidance\"\u003eChoosing a size\u003c\/h3\u003e\u003cp\u003eThis plant is supplied in one size, 12L, at $88.95 per plant. Read our guide to \u003ca href=\"\/blogs\/news\/low-water-gardens-australia\"\u003elow water gardens\u003c\/a\u003e.\u003c\/p\u003e","brand":"Plant Drop","offers":[{"title":"12L","offer_id":64309240299889,"sku":null,"price":88.95,"currency_code":"AUD","in_stock":true}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/1017\/1049\/6113\/files\/fji7XoeS89yS7J-2sEQMn_SuW6bUVi.jpg?v=1787628545"},{"product_id":"olive-olea-europa-verdale","title":"Olive - Olea europa Verdale","description":"\u003cp\u003eIn South Australian groves the Verdale name has a long history, though it covers more than one tree, a French Verdale and a locally established strain, and nurseries do not always separate them. What they share is a reputation as a hardy, productive oil cultivar suited to hot dry summers and alkaline limestone soils, precisely the ground that defeats many other fruit trees.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eIn a garden it forms a spreading evergreen canopy of narrow grey green leaves, moves at a slow to moderate pace, and needs very little water once its roots are down. Give it full sun. An olive in shade goes thin and weak and picks up scale and sooty mould.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003ePrune to open the centre so light reaches the inner wood, since fruit is carried on the previous season's growth. Read our guide to \u003ca href=\"\/blogs\/news\/low-water-gardens-australia\"\u003elow water gardens\u003c\/a\u003e.\u003c\/p\u003e","brand":"Plant Drop","offers":[{"title":"90L","offer_id":64309240332657,"sku":null,"price":519.0,"currency_code":"AUD","in_stock":true}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/1017\/1049\/6113\/files\/OK0M6UCm-aL356sV0-p0N_ae90o3hO.jpg?v=1787628610"},{"product_id":"olive-olea-europaea-correggiola","title":"Olive - Olea europaea Correggiola","description":"\u003cp\u003eUnder its Tuscan name or under the closely related Frantoio label, Correggiola is one of the classic Italian oil olives, and it is planted as much for its shape as for its fruit. The branches are noticeably pendulous, giving a soft, weeping outline that reads far less rigid than the upright table cultivars, and the leaves are long, narrow and silver on the underside. It also has a good name as a pollinator, so it is a sensible addition if you already have another olive or two in the ground.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eSizes here run from a 140mm right through to 90 litre, which covers a hedge line planted young as well as an instant feature tree. These are Manzanillo olives already trained flat as espaliers, which means several years of shaping work is done and your job is to hold the plane rather than rebuild it. Fix the plant to horizontal wires or a trellis as soon as it goes in, tie with soft ties, and check them each season so they do not cut into thickening wood.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eManzanillo is the large fruited Spanish table olive, naturally more spreading and lower branching than the upright oil types, which is part of why it takes to espalier work so readily. Ripe fruit drops and stains, so think twice before running one along rendered render or above pale paving.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eFull sun and drainage matter above all else. A north or west facing wall throws back plenty of heat, which olives enjoy, but it also dries the soil fast through the first summer. Swan Hill was selected in northern Victoria as a non fruiting form, and it sets next to nothing, which removes the stained paving, the slippery mess around a pool and the bird spread seedlings that make ordinary olives a weed risk in parts of southern Australia. Its flowers also shed very little viable pollen, which is why it turns up in council plantings and around schools.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eEverything else is standard olive, and that is the appeal. Grey green leaves with silver undersides that move in the slightest breeze, a trunk that gains character and gnarl with age, and a tolerance of heat, wind, alkaline soil and long dry spells once established.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eFull sun and drainage are the two requirements. It takes shaping well, whether that is a clean single trunk over paving, a clipped ball in a pot, or a row pruned into a hedge along a driveway.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003ch3 class=\"pd-size-guidance\"\u003eChoosing a size\u003c\/h3\u003e\u003cp\u003eThis plant is available in 7 sizes, from 200mm up to 200L, priced from $38.95 to $1529.00 per plant. Kalamata is a Greek table cultivar with large, tapered, almond-shaped olives that darken to purple-black, and it is a curing olive rather than a pressing olive, so plan on brine buckets rather than a press.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eCrops improve with a second variety nearby for cross pollination, and flower set depends on a genuinely cold winter, which is why the same tree fruits well in central Victoria and sulks in a warm coastal garden further north. Growth is slow to moderate and it accepts hard pruning without complaint, so it works as a clipped screen or a silver-grey feature just as well as an orchard tree. Full sun, and once the roots are down it asks for very little water.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eTwo warnings. Dropped fruit stains paving, so keep it away from the entertaining area. And in parts of South Australia and Victoria feral olives are a recognised weed problem, so collect windfalls in bush-adjacent gardens.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003ch3 class=\"pd-size-guidance\"\u003eChoosing a size\u003c\/h3\u003e\u003cp\u003eThis plant is supplied in one size, 5L, at $40.95 per plant. The tree is moderately vigorous with a spreading, open frame and the usual grey-green foliage that flips silver in wind.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eIt will set a reasonable crop on its own, but fruit set improves noticeably with a second variety nearby flowering at the same time. Full sun, freely draining soil and restraint with water and fertiliser are all it asks, because olives fruit poorly when they are pampered.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eOn the east coast the pest to watch is olive lace bug, which mottles and drops leaves from the inside of the canopy outward, so check leaf undersides in spring. In parts of South Australia and Victoria self-sown olives are a recognised environmental weed, so pick up fallen fruit.
